I used to have a 600 FZS Fazer when i was in the UK, good bike handled well, wa comfy and reasonable weather protection. However budget bike with a rear mono shock that would need replacing at 20-30k, And bearing in mind the age and they were popular as commuters most will be well used. The later FZ6's have a peaky engine (R6 rather than Thundercat) and for that sort of bike not always what you want, and the hornet and Kwaka Z750 seem to win out on tests on these later models. Also as an alternative might want to look at the big trail bikes ie Tiger 900, Africa Twin, Caponord, V-Strom, etc, Comfy two up. Or for a strong six hundred tourer look at the ZZR600 produced up until a year or so ago in the uk.
